1. The Importance of High-Quality Cables

🎡 Your sound is only as good as your signal chain, and a quality bass guitar cable is a crucial part of that chain. A high-quality cable ensures that your low frequencies remain intact, providing a rich and punchy sound. It minimizes signal loss and interference, resulting in a cleaner tone. Additionally, a durable cable will withstand the rigors of regular gigging, reducing the risk of unexpected failures.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Are bass guitar cables interchangeable with regular guitar cables?

Yes, bass guitar cables can be used interchangeably with regular guitar cables as they both use standard 1/4-inch connectors.

2. Can a high-quality cable improve my bass guitar’s tone?

While a high-quality cable can enhance signal clarity, it may not significantly alter the overall tone of your bass guitar.

3. What length of cable should I choose for live performances?

For live performances, it’s best to choose a cable between 10 to 20 feet long to allow freedom of movement on stage.

4. Can a longer cable affect the sound quality?

Yes, longer cables may cause some signal loss and high-frequency roll-off, but the impact is generally negligible within common lengths.

5. Are gold-plated connectors worth the extra cost?

Gold-plated connectors provide better conductivity and corrosion resistance, making them a good investment for long-term use.

6. Can I use a bass guitar cable for other instruments?

Absolutely! Bass guitar cables are suitable for other instruments with 1/4-inch outputs, such as electric guitars and keyboards.

7. Is it necessary to use a shielded cable for bass guitars?

Yes, a shielded cable is essential for bass guitars to minimize interference from other electronic devices and maintain signal integrity.

8. Can I make my own bass guitar cable?

Yes, if you have the necessary tools and skills, you can make your own bass guitar cable. However, it’s crucial to ensure proper shielding and insulation for optimal performance.

9. Should I prioritize cable thickness for durability?

While thicker cables may offer increased durability, it’s not the only factor to consider. A well-built cable with quality connectors and robust insulation can also provide excellent longevity.

10. Can a faulty cable damage my bass guitar amp?

In most cases, a faulty cable won’t damage your bass guitar amp. However, it may cause intermittent connections, signal dropouts, or undesirable noise.

11. How often should I replace my bass guitar cable?

The lifespan of a bass guitar cable depends on usage and care. With regular gigging, it’s recommended to replace your cable every 1-2 years or if you notice any signs of wear and tear.

12. Do braided cables offer any advantages?

Braided cables provide increased flexibility and resistance to tangling, making them easier to manage during performances or storage.

13. Can I use wireless systems instead of cables?

Yes, wireless systems offer freedom of movement on stage but keep in mind that they may introduce latency and require additional equipment.
